KitsuneC2
→ View on GitHubKitsuneC2 is a pure-Go adversary emulation framework designed for security testing, providing both a web and CLI interface for user interaction with implants. Its notable features include dynamic implant generation, in-memory execution of shellcode, and malleable C2 traffic, making it a versatile tool for organizations aiming to evaluate their cybersecurity defenses. However, it is not intended for professional engagements as there are more mature frameworks available.
